Color Meaning and Usage

A soft blue tone, #D7D4ED has RGB (215, 212, 237) and HSL (247°, 41%, 88%). Known for evoking purity and simplicity, this very light tint is often used for branding and logos.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#D7D4ED is #EAEDD4,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#D4DDED.
